Transaction d533243f23ef273ae2fc7d7664af9d899caa380258a8064742d497ca11addf33
1 Input
2 Outputs
- d533243f23ef273ae2fc7d7664af9d899caa380258a8064742d497ca11addf33:0
- d533243f23ef273ae2fc7d7664af9d899caa380258a8064742d497ca11addf33:1
value 44513
address 1H4yCPTnuv9RgdKm59Moe1v9ECGPCKWcS2
value 161749
address 3FAtbqNfhCLWSwxQVDj53yaLz2kEjTFQJ9